Painting Description
"A River Landscape With Travellers By A Ruined Fort" is an evocative painting by the Dutch artist Jacob de Heusch, a notable figure of the late 17th and early 18th centuries. Born in Utrecht in 1657, de Heusch was part of a family of artists and was heavily influenced by his uncle, Willem de Heusch, who was also a painter. Jacob de Heusch is often associated with the Italianate landscape style, a genre that combines the naturalistic depiction of the Dutch landscape with the idealized and classical elements of Italian scenery.
The painting "A River Landscape With Travellers By A Ruined Fort" exemplifies de Heusch's skill in blending these two influences. The composition features a serene river scene, with a group of travelers making their way along the banks near the remnants of an ancient fort. The ruins, possibly inspired by de Heusch's travels in Italy, add a sense of historical depth and romantic decay to the landscape. The travelers, depicted in contemporary 17th-century attire, provide a narrative element, suggesting themes of journey and exploration.
De Heusch's use of light and shadow in this painting is particularly noteworthy. The soft, diffused light creates a tranquil atmosphere, while the detailed rendering of the foliage and water reflects his keen observation of nature. The artist's palette, dominated by earthy tones and muted greens, enhances the sense of harmony and balance in the scene.
This work is a testament to Jacob de Heusch's ability to capture the beauty and complexity of the natural world, while also imbuing his landscapes with a sense of timelessness and poetic resonance. "A River Landscape With Travellers By A Ruined Fort" remains an important example of Dutch Italianate landscape painting, showcasing the cross-cultural influences that shaped European art during this period.
